Communicate of a Girls’s Nationwide Basketball Affiliation staff coming to Oakland is catching on, so Oakland Voice journalists requested citizens what they consider a WNBA staff probably calling Oakland house. Will they be right here to strengthen the visiting staff and produce their friends and family to the video games? What would a rejuvenated Coliseum area seem like?

The African American Sports activities and Leisure Staff (AASEG) has expressed its want to carry a WNBA staff to Oakland, with former participant Alana Beard main the trouble. In February, the Town of Oakland introduced an settlement with the gang to transport ahead. The undertaking nonetheless has a protracted approach to move. However present plans come with housing, a tradition heart, a lodge and education schemes, which might value greater than $5 billion.

Oakland athletes proved just lately that ladies and feminine athletes can draw crowds and be top-of-the-line of their box. The Oakland Tech ladies’ basketball staff — aka the “Girl Bulldogs” — clinched its 3rd instantly state championship name Friday on the Golden 1 Heart in Sacramento.
